5. Project First edition
We chose Rio de Janeiro, and Brazil, to host our first edition as the city and country
witnessed drastic changes over the last decade.
Biggest economy in Latin America, Brazil is often referred to as “the capital of
social networks” to illustrate the pace with which people adopted new behaviors.
With the World Cup and the Olympic Games, Rio epitomizes these changes with a
vivid digital ecosystem and smart city programs.

6. The conference will be held in the amphitheater of the Museu do Amanhã.
Designed by architect Diego Calatrava, the museum was built on Pier Mauá and is
a symbol of the urban renovation project called “Porto Maravilha” that happened in
the center of Rio. The museum opened in 2015.
The institution wants to highlight the changes and future possibilities of mankind,
which echoes the ambition of .
Production of the event will be done by Rock Communications and the CCFB
(Câmara de Cómercio França Brasil).

13. • Thursday 25/05 morning:
MOBILE
Brazil has the highest number of SIM cards per
inhabitant in the world (240M for a population
of 200M). With mobile being the main access
point to the Internet, we see new behaviors
creating challenges and opportunities for
newcomers and for incumbents.
• Thursday 25/05 afternoon:
TECHNOLOGY
Mobile technologies sparked new behaviors
calling for new services, providers and rules. But
much more is underway with Artificial
Intelligence, Augmented and Virtual Reality, 3D
printing or even robots.
Agenda 2 days of conference
• Friday 26/05 morning:
DATA
Data is the common denominator of all
innovation. Often spoken of but rarely
understood, one has to know how to collect
data, organize it and act on it to transform
data into more efficient decisions and actions.
• Friday 26/05 afternoon:
PEOPLE
Yet, in the end, it’s people who make decisions
and implement them. New skill sets are
needed from providers and employees while
education itself is being transformed and
announces a different future.
